JAVA之建立一个m行n列的矩阵,并找出其中最小的元素所在的行和列

来源:互联网 发布:淘宝上下架是什么意思 编辑:程序博客网 时间:2024/06/04 08:50
package test;import java.util.Scanner;public class DEMO2 {public static void main(String[] args) {int m,n,min,i,j,row=0,col=0;Scanner s=new Scanner(System.in); System.out.println("请输入您想创建的矩阵的行数与列数,m为行,n为列");System.out.print("m=");m=s.nextInt();System.out.print("n=");n=s.nextInt();int a[][]=new int[m][n];System.out.println("请接连输入存储的数字:");for(i=0;i<m;i++){for(j=0;j<n;j++){a[i][j]=s.nextInt();}}System.out.println("输出矩阵如下:");for(i=0;i<m;i++){for(j=0;j<n;j++){System.out.print(a[i][j]+" ");}System.out.println();}min=a[row][col];for(i=0;i<m;i++){for(j=0;j<n;j++){if(min>a[i][j]){min=a[i][j];row=i;col=j;}}}System.out.println("最小元素的行与列为:");System.out.println("行:"+(row+1)+"\n"+"列"+(col+1));System.out.println("最小值为:"+a[row][col]);}}//代码仅供参考哦~~~

运行后的结果如下:


0 0
原创粉丝点击